91) __________ involves the analysis of accumulated data and involves a __________. a) OLAP, database b) OLAP, data warehouse c) OLTP, database d) OLTP, data warehouse
OLAP is used for the analysis of accumulated data, and it requires a data warehouse.
while OLTP is used for transaction processing and requires a database optimized for real-time transaction processing. The analysis of accumulated data is known as Online Analytical Processing (OLAP), and it involves a data warehouse. OLAP is a business intelligence tool used for multi-dimensional analysis of large data sets, while a data warehouse is a central repository that stores historical and current data from multiple sources in a structured manner. OLAP allows users to perform complex queries on large data sets, analyze trends, and make informed business decisions. It is often used in data mining and decision support systems. OLAP tools can be used to slice and dice data, drill down to more detailed data, and roll up to higher levels of summary data. OLAP is primarily used for analytical purposes and is not designed for transaction processing. On the other hand, a data warehouse is designed to support OLAP and is used for storing large amounts of historical data that can be queried and analyzed. Data is extracted from various sources, transformed, and loaded into the data warehouse in a structured format, enabling efficient querying and analysis. OLTP (Online Transaction Processing), on the other hand, is a type of transaction processing that is designed for processing real-time transactions in databases. It is used for day-to-day operations such as order processing, inventory management, and customer management. OLTP is optimized for processing large volumes of transactions in real-time, and is not suitable for analytical purposes.
In summary, OLAP is used for the analysis of accumulated data, and it requires a data warehouse, while OLTP is used for transaction processing and requires a database optimized for real-time transaction processing.

The dimensions of the rectangular poster are 9 inches by 22 inches.
Let's assume the width of the rectangular poster is x inches.
According to the given information, the length of the poster is 4 more inches than two times its width. So, the length can be expressed as 2x + 4 inches.
The formula for the area of a rectangle is length × width. In this case, the area is given as 198 square inches.
Therefore, we have the equation:
(2x + 4) × x = 198
Expanding the equation:
\(2x^2 + 4x = 198\)
Rearranging the equation to standard quadratic form:
\(2x^2 + 4x - 198 = 0\)
To solve this quadratic equation, we can use factoring, completing the square, or the quadratic formula. Let's use the quadratic formula:
x = (-b ± √\((b^2 - 4ac\))) / (2a)
Plugging in the values:
x = (-4 ± √\((4^2 - 4(2)(-198)))\) / (2(2))
x = (-4 ± √(16 + 1584)) / 4
x = (-4 ± √1600) / 4
x = (-4 ± 40) / 4
Simplifying:
x = (-4 + 40) / 4 = 9
x = (-4 - 40) / 4 = -11
Since we are dealing with dimensions, the width cannot be negative. Therefore, the width of the poster is 9 inches.
Substituting the value of x back into the length equation:
Length = 2x + 4 = 2(9) + 4 = 18 + 4 = 22 inches

when a confounding variable is present in an experiment, one cannot tell whether the results were due to the
When a confounding variable is present in an experiment, one cannot tell whether the results were due to the treatment or the confounding variable.
A confounding variable is an extraneous factor that is associated with both the independent variable (treatment) and the dependent variable (results/outcome). It can introduce bias and create ambiguity in determining the true cause of the observed effects.
In the presence of a confounding variable, it becomes challenging to attribute the results solely to the treatment being studied. The confounding variable may have its own influence on the outcome, making it difficult to disentangle its effects from those of the treatment. As a result, any observed differences or correlations between the treatment and the outcome could be confounded by the presence of this variable.
To address the issue of confounding variables, researchers employ various strategies such as randomization, matching, or statistical techniques like regression analysis and analysis of covariance (ANCOVA). These methods aim to control for confounding variables and isolate the effect of the treatment of interest.
In summary, when a confounding variable is present in an experiment, it hampers the ability to determine whether the observed results are solely due to the treatment or if they are influenced by the confounding variable. Careful study design and statistical analysis are crucial in order to minimize the impact of confounding and draw accurate conclusions about the effects of the treatment.
